The Interplay of Truth and Deception (New Agendas in Communication Series) Book

Presents a conceptualization of the phenomena of lying and deception, manifested in some well-known constructions like spin, hype, doublespeak, equivocation, and contextomy (quoting out of context). This title is suitable for scholars, researchers, and advanced/graduate students in communication, media, and psychology.Read More
